Description

Ethyl 6,7-Difluoro-1-Methyl-4-Oxo-4H-[1,3]Thiazeto[3,2-A]Quinoline-3-Carboxylate is a high-purity, advanced pharmaceutical intermediate with the CAS number 113046-72-3. This compound is a critical building block in the synthesis of novel fluoroquinolone-based antibacterial agents, offering significant value in modern drug discovery. It is primarily required by research institutions and pharmaceutical manufacturers engaged in developing next-generation antibiotics and other therapeutic molecules.

Application

  • Pharmaceutical Intermediate: Key precursor in the synthesis of new-generation fluoroquinolone antibiotics.
  • Antibacterial Research: Used in R&D for developing compounds with activity against resistant bacterial strains.
  • Organic Synthesis: Serves as a versatile scaffold for constructing complex heterocyclic compounds in medicinal chemistry.
  • Chemical Reference Standard: Utilized as a high-purity standard for analytical method development and quality control in API manufacturing.
  • Academic Research: Employed in university and institutional labs for studying structure-activity relationships (SAR) of quinolone derivatives.

Basic Information

Product Name Ethyl 6,7-Difluoro-1-Methyl-4-Oxo-4H-[1,3]Thiazeto[3,2-A]Quinoline-3-Carboxylate
CAS No. 113046-72-3
Molecular Formula C₁₅H₁₂F₂N₂O₃S
Molecular Weight 338.33 g/mol
Synonyms 6,7-Difluoro-1-methyl-4-oxo-4H-[1,3]thiazeto[3,2-a]quinoline-3-carboxylic acid ethyl ester; Ethyl 6,7-difluoro-1-methyl-4-oxo-1,4-dihydro-[1,3]thiazeto[3,2-a]quinoline-3-carboxylate; 113046-72-3; Thiazetoquinoline carboxylate derivative; Fluoroquinolone intermediate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ed to prevent moisture absorption, which may affect stability and performance.
